Output 76fbabc809d636238a1b91d9414ce908e376640fb50873279658226c925850bc:0

value
29553705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a3366f4530821c1dab8a880aca4bddbb67b4822 OP_EQUAL
address
3HCxNe5DuhafYXCLuzpaKqa7S63hEYMzye
transaction
76fbabc809d636238a1b91d9414ce908e376640fb50873279658226c925850bc
spent
true